BACKGROUND
Corbett spent twenty years in banking primarily in the commercial loan area. In his last position he was Senior Vice President for Fleet Bank where he worked for twelve years. In this capacity he was manager of regional corporate lending for the Rochester and the Finger Lakes regions. His 280 million dollar portfolio was made up of small to medium size companies involved in manufacturing, distribution, construction, retailing, not-for-profit, and real estate development.
In 1991 he took advantage of a voluntary separation package offered to employees at his level so he could start his own broker & consultant business. What Corbett recognized was that the lending environment in the U.S. had undergone a permanent structural change which made it both more difficult for small businesses to borrow, and more complex for businesses to meet the lending requirements of their existing lenders. He also recognized that the existing industry of brokers and consultants were not providing the professionalism and sophistication level needed by small business.
SERVICES OFFERED Loan Broker
In this capacity Corbett locates financing for business through banks, venture capital groups, insurance companies, pension funds, finance companies, and individuals. The financing involved is for a multitude of purposes including real estate, equipment financing, operating lines, permanent working capital, etc.
Specifically, Corbett prepares a detailed package covering the business's history, industry, financial analysis, cash flows etc. before approaching a lender. He then matches up the best fit of borrower and lender based on the type and size of financing needed, geographic location etc. Corbett handles all contacts and negotiations with the potential lender working along with the client. In the final phase, Corbett assists the client in evaluating loan proposals. Corbett will not accept a client unless he feels he can locate financing that makes sense for the borrower.
Business Consultant
In this capacity Corbett does business valuations, market analysis, analysis of commercial real estate, evaluations of potential business deals and operating companies. Additionally, he analyzes businesses providing written recommendations as well as preparing business plans. This service can be as detailed as the client desires, but it is not acting as an accountant or comptroller for the company. His services are intended to be broad based and general, taking a macro approach to the business.
Retainer Arrangement
Corbett handles all facets of financing on an on-going basis, dealing with the lenders' periodic requirements as the representative for the business. In addition, he provides analysis of the business, assists in long term planning and builds an historical database of financial information to help the business understand their strengths and weaknesses. Corbett will get involved in any aspect of the business the client desires, bringing in specialized expertise when necessary based on the numerous contacts he's made over the years. Corbett uses his twenty years of banking experience to help businesses avoid the pitfalls he has seen having viewed thousands of companies which have experienced success, failure, or a mixture of both.
